Job description
This role will report to our Stevens Point, WI office.
What You'll Do:
Assist with development of standard and ad hoc reports, containing complex data sets, to demonstrate campaign results and program performance. Analyzes findings to detect trends, uncover insights, identify barriers, and highlight opportunities. Provides SEO leadership with recommendations to improve marketing processes and Return on Investments (ROI) in the future.
Identify key conversion points in the marketing funnel through utilization of qualitative and quantitative data. Analyzes findings to detect root cause of gains and/or losses in traffic and/or conversions and determines necessary changes to remedy the same.
Assist with development and execution of Conversion Rate Optimization (CRO) strategies based on findings to increase revenue.
Manage SEM campaigns across Sentry business lines with the support and oversight of the SEO analyst.
Implements and maintains online tracking tools to analyze user behavior and fuel future testing hypotheses regarding conversions, customer journeys, funnel analysis, and multi-channel attribution.
Build and manages optimization tests in concert with other marketing teams to gather feedback on proposed enhancements. Analyzes results and translates findings into recommendations that help improve overall website performance and user experience. Collaborates with Marketing and IT teams to implement changes.
Collaborate with marketing team members to develop and maintain KPI dashboards and cross-channel performance reports to provide actionable insights based on trends and emerging patterns. Presents findings and recommendations to marketing and business leadership to capitalize on optimization opportunities.
Partner with Advanced Analytics to share data and create integrated reporting that measures results and provides data driven observations and holistic performance reporting.
Manage landing pages, website CTAs, and lead-generating forms to optimize conversion funnels and increase the performance of webpages.
Maintain awareness of CRO best practices and analyzes trends to improve processes and capitalize on optimization opportunities.
Perform other job-related duties as assigned from time to time.
What It Takes:
Bachelors Degree in Mathematics, Computer Science, Statistics, Economics, or equivalent work experience.
Experience in data models and creating best-practice reports based on data mining, analysis and visualization Strong analytical skills to ensure clear analysis and sound data-based decision-making
Critical thinking skills
Written and oral communication skills
Organizational skills to coordinate, request and control data from numerous sources Ability to analyze large datasets
Intermediate to advanced Proficiency in Google Analytics, Google Adwords, Google Tag Manager, Google Search Console, Google Optimize, Optimizely, Tableau, Excel, Google Data Studio
